Background
The bearing is an important part in the modern mechanical equipment, and the main function of the bearing is to support a mechanical rotating body, reduce the friction coefficient in the movement process of the mechanical rotating body and ensure the rotation precision of the mechanical rotating body. The bearing is pressed in to be an important link in the bearing assembling process, the pressing in of the bearing is performed by an operator through a hand hammer at present, the manual assembling mode is time-consuming and labor-consuming, the efficiency is extremely low, the assembling design requirement is difficult to ensure, and the occurrence of workpiece knocking and industrial accidents is easier to occur.

Detailed Description
As shown in figures 1, 2, 3 and 4, as shown in fig. 5 and 6, a semi-automatic bearing assembling machine comprises a main frame 1, a pressure head 2, a workbench 3 and a lifting oil cylinder 5, wherein the lifting oil cylinder 5 is fixed on an oil cylinder supporting plate 17 at the top of the main frame, a piston rod below the lifting oil cylinder 5 is connected with a flange 24 at the top of the pressure head through a fixing bolt 4, the flange 24 of the pressure head is connected with a pressing plate 21 through a branch pipe 23, a rib plate 22 is connected between the pressing plate and the flange of the pressure head, a bedplate 16 of the main frame is fixed on a supporting leg 15 of the main frame and is connected with a stand column 14 of the main frame, the workbench 3 is connected with the bedplate 16 of the main frame through a bolt fixing piece 7, a lower guide bar 9 and an upper guide bar 10 are respectively arranged on the workbench, guide grooves 8 are respectively arranged in the middle parts of the lower guide bar and the upper guide bar, a guide plate 11 is arranged in the guide grooves.
The utility model discloses during the assembly machine uses, operating personnel adjusts adjustable slider's interval according to the specification of waiting to assemble the bearing, at first will wait to assemble the bearing frame and arrange in between the adjustable slider on the workstation, then arrange the bearing frame top in with the bearing, thereby the assembly of impressing of bearing is accomplished with the pressure head decline to the rethread lift cylinder.
